Section 6. Maintenance/Cleaning

Maintaining your I-Pure System requires minimal
work but will maximize the performance and life of the
system.
Section 6.1 Cell Maintenance
Our clear Cell allows for easy regular inspections for calcium build up. Visually check the Cell
periodically, and clean it as necessary (1 to 2 times per year). Advanced self-cleaning technologies,
including reverse polarization and IBT™ help the cell stay cleaner than other self-cleaning cells, but
minimal biannual cleanings are required.
Section 6.2 Cell Cleaning
Do Not use metal or other hard objects to clean the cell as this could scratch the precious coating on the
plates and void the warranty.
Always add acid to water, NOT water to acid
Diluted Muriatic Acid solution = 10 parts water to 1 part acid
Note: Follow the instructions of the acid manufacturer.

Cleaning With Optional Cleaning Cap

1.
Remove the cell from the line by undoing the
electrical connections from the Cell and the
barrel unions from the cell ends.
2.
Remove the black o-rings on the ends of the
Cell. (Fig. 1)
3.
Attach the Cell Cleaning Cap to one end of
Cell. (Fig. 2)
